vue 渲染页面的时候 出现闪烁问题的解决办法

在使用vue绑定数据的时候,渲染页面时会出现变量闪烁

<div id="h_cameraman" v-cloak>

  <public-nav>

    {{ msg }}

  </public-nav>

</div>

加载的时候就会看到 {{msg }}

解决办法: 给最外层的标签 加上  v-cloak 

css里面:[v-cloak]{

      display:none;
    }

 

ps: 有时候可能没有用   可能是   [v-cloak]{ display:none;} 的层级被覆盖掉了 , 你需要提高它的层级  [v-cloak]{ display:none !important ;} ,也有可能你把它放进了 @import 引入的css文件中 , 它放在@import引入的文件的是没有作用的,你可以放在link引入的文件来使用,或者直接写在页面的<style></style>标签中!

posted @ 2018-07-05 17:22  何必再忆  阅读(2060)  评论(0编辑  收藏  举报